The Role of Volatility in the Raider Experience
Volatility, often referred to as variance, dictates how frequently a slot pays out, as well as the size of those payouts. A high volatility jackpot raider game will offer fewer wins, but those wins will tend to be significantly larger, mirroring the unpredictable nature of discovering a major archaeological find. Conversely, a low volatility game offers more frequent, smaller wins, creating a steadier, but potentially less thrilling, experience. Players should consider their personal preferences and risk tolerance when choosing a game. Those seeking excitement and the chance for a life-changing win may gravitate towards high-volatility options, while those who prefer a more consistent and less stressful gameplay loop may opt for low-volatility games. Many modern slots now display a volatility rating, or offer information about the game’s hit frequency, enabling players to make informed decisions.
| Volatility Level | Win Frequency | Payout Size | Suitable Player |
|---|---|---|---|
| Low | High | Small | Conservative Player |
| Medium | Moderate | Moderate | Balanced Player |
| High | Low | Large | Risk-Taking Player |

Bonus Features and Interactive Elements
The modern jackpot raider slot is rarely content with simply spinning reels. Interactive bonus features are now integral to the experience, designed to mimic the challenges and rewards of a real-life expedition. These features frequently trigger when specific symbol combinations are achieved, and they can range from simple free spins rounds to elaborate mini-games. For example, a “pick-and-click” bonus might present players with a selection of hidden artifacts, each concealing a different prize. Another common feature is a cascading reels mechanic, where winning symbols disappear and are replaced by new ones, potentially triggering multiple wins from a single spin. The integration of progressive jackpots also adds a significant layer of excitement, offering players the chance to win a life-altering sum of money. These bonus features aren’t merely about increasing win potential; they’re about enhancing the narrative and creating a sense of involvement. They transform the player from a passive spectator to an active participant in the adventure.
